Advertisement

人工利用MATLAB生成二维数据点。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该程序利用MATLAB环境,能够生成二维数据点,从而创建出若干个基础性的流行结构数据集,这些数据集特别适合用于聚类算法的测试与评估。此外,该MATLAB基础程序设计简洁明了,并附有详细的注释说明,操作起来十分便捷。请各位同仁理解,此代码仅供个人积分获取之用,希望世界和平安康!

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LAB
    优质
    本教程介绍在MATLAB环境中使用编程技术来合成具有特定分布特性的二维数据集的方法和实例。适合初学者学习掌握相关技能。 MATLAB生成2维数据点的程序可以创建一些简单的流行结构数据集,用于聚类测试。这是一个基础且易于使用的MATLAB程序,并附有详细注释。高手请绕行,这里只为积累积分而发帖,愿世界和平。
  • MATLAB从三高程DEM图
    优质
    本项目介绍如何使用MATLAB软件处理三维高程点数据,并通过插值算法生成详细的数字地形模型(DEM)图像。 使用XYZ点表和蒂洛尼三角网在MATLAB中绘制DEM图像。
  • Synthesis.rar_集__合
    优质
    Synthesis.rar 是一个包含二维人工合成数据的数据集,适用于多种机器学习和计算机视觉应用场景。该数据集通过算法生成,提供丰富的训练样本以增强模型性能。 用于聚类的人工合成数据集通常是二维的,便于可视化。
  • qrencode-3.4.4
    优质
    本段介绍如何使用qrencode-3.4.4工具生成高质量二维码,涵盖命令行参数设置及常见问题解决方法。 二维码(Quick Response Code)是一种二维条形码技术,能够存储大量信息如网址、文本及图片数据,在移动互联网时代广泛应用于产品标识、信息分享与支付等领域。qrencode是一个开源的二维码编码库,提供多种编码格式并具备便捷API供开发者使用。 **qrencode 3.4.4** 该版本为稳定版,包含多项改进和优化功能。利用此版本,开发人员能够轻松将文本、URL及其他数据转换成二维码图像。主要特点如下: 1. **多级纠错支持**:提供四种不同级别的错误校正(L, M, Q, H)以应对各种损坏或污染情况。 2. **多种输出格式**:除了BMP外,还支持PNG、JPEG和SVG等其他图片格式,适用于在各类平台上显示与使用二维码图像。 3. **自定义参数设置**:允许调整边框大小、模块颜色以及生成的图像尺寸以适应不同的应用场景需求。 **MFC (Microsoft Foundation Classes)** 微软提供的C++类库用于构建Windows应用程序,尤其适合图形用户界面(GUI)开发。在本项目中,使用MFC作为DEMO程序的基础框架来简化创建对话框、菜单和控件等任务,并通过此平台展示qrencode生成的二维码图像。 **MFC与qrencode结合** 1. **集成过程**:需将qrencode库编译为适用于Windows系统的动态链接库(DLL)或静态库(LIB),然后将其与MFC项目进行连接。 2. **调用API**: 在构建的应用程序中,可以使用如`QRcode_encodeString()`函数等QREncode API编码数据。 3. **生成图像**:通过qrencode的二维码数据创建一个BMP格式图片文件,例如运用`QRcode_generateBmp()`功能。 4. **显示图像**: 利用MFC中的控件或类加载并展示BMP图片到对话框上,便于用户直观查看生成的二维码。 **应用场景** 1. **信息分享**:应用中允许输入文本或URL后立即生成二维码供他人扫描获取所需的信息内容。 2. **配置文件管理**: 设备设置时使用二维码存储配置数据简化操作流程。 3. **支付凭证创建**:产生包含支付详情的二维码,用户可直接扫码完成交易过程。 4. **电子票务系统**:利用此技术生成用于入场验证的电子门票二维码。 综上所述,qrencode-3.4.4与MFC结合为开发Windows平台上的二维码应用程序提供了高效且灵活的方式。开发者能够快速构建具备二维码功能的应用程序以提升用户体验,并展示了开源软件在实际应用中的强大潜力。
  • MATLAB随机
    优质
    本教程介绍如何使用MATLAB软件生成和可视化二维随机数点,涵盖基本语法及常用函数,适用于初学者学习掌握。 在MATLAB中生成二维随机数并计算均值向量和协方差矩阵的方法如下:首先使用`mvnrnd`函数或相关命令来产生所需的随机数据点;接着利用这些数据点,可以通过调用相应的统计函数如`mean`和`cov`来分别求出均值向量与协方差。
  • QRCODE技术
    优质
    本项目旨在通过运用QRCODE技术,高效、便捷地为各类信息生成二维码,适用于产品推广、信息安全等多个领域。 在IT行业中,二维码(Quick Response Code,简称QR码)是一种二维条形码技术,能够存储大量文本数据,如网址、联系信息、图像等内容。用户可以通过移动设备扫描这些代码快速访问相关信息。 本项目基于QT5.9.9和Visual Studio 2015开发而成,旨在实现二维码的生成功能。 让我们深入了解QT框架。QT是一个跨平台的C++图形界面应用程序开发工具包,由Qt公司维护和支持。它提供了一整套库文件及组件用于创建桌面、移动与嵌入式设备上的应用软件,并支持Windows、Linux、Android和iOS等操作系统。 在使用QT生成二维码时,我们可以借助QZXing库完成这一任务。QZXing是基于开源的Zxing(Zebra Crossing)条形码解析器开发的Qt版本,在其基础上可以轻易实现二维码的数据编码与解码功能。 以下是利用QT及QZXing进行QR代码创建的基本步骤: 1. **集成QZXing**:需要将库文件添加至项目中,这通常包括下载源代码、编译以及将其头文件和库链接到项目的配置里。 2. **引入相关类与接口**:在编写程序时需引用QZXing的相应头文件,例如`#include ` 和 `#include `。 3. **创建二维码数据**:使用`QZXingEncoder` 类提供的功能输入待编码的信息,并指定合适的编码类型(如QR_CODE)。 4. **设置参数**:可调整错误校正级别、版本号及边框大小等,以满足特定需求。 5. **生成图像文件**:通过调用 `QZXingEncoder::encode()` 方法产生包含二维码的`QImage`对象。 6. **展示或保存结果**:可以将该图片显示在QT框架下的`QLabel`控件中或者将其另存为PNG、JPEG等格式。 本项目“qrTest”可能提供一个简单的示例程序,演示了如何使用QT5.9.9和VS2015来生成二维码。通过这个例子可以看到集成QZXing库的方法以及从用户输入数据创建并显示QR码的过程。运行该程序有助于理解这些技术在实际中的应用。 总结来说,项目的核心内容涵盖了对QT框架的应用、QZXing的使用方式、二维码生成逻辑及图像处理方法的学习。这不仅帮助开发者掌握如何利用QT环境生成QR代码,还加深了他们对于跨平台开发的理解,并为需要在此类功能上进行扩展或创新的团队提供了有价值的参考资源。
  • 优质
    二维码生成工具是一款便捷的应用程序或在线服务,用于创建二维码。用户可以轻松地将文本、网址等信息转换为二维码,适用于多种场景如名片分享、网站推广和资料传递等。 在数字化时代,二维码作为一种便捷的信息传递工具,在各个领域得到了广泛应用。利用编程语言生成个性化、功能丰富的二维码更是技术发展的体现。本段落将围绕“qrcode二维码生成器”这一主题,详细解析其背后的实现原理和技术应用,特别关注Pyside2和Python的结合使用。 首先需要了解的是,“qrcode二维码生成器”是基于Python的qrcode库构建的。这是一个强大且易用的模块,能够将各种类型的数据(如文本、URL等)编码为符合国际标准的二维码图像。在该生成器中,用户可以自定义二维码的颜色方案,包括前景色、背景色以及定位码色,从而实现个性化设计。 Pyside2作为Qt库的Python绑定,在这个生成器中扮演着关键角色。Qt是一个跨平台的应用程序开发框架,广泛用于创建图形用户界面(GUI)。Pyside2提供了丰富的控件和功能,使得开发者能轻松构建交互式的桌面应用程序。在qrcode二维码生成器中,它负责创建用户界面,允许用户输入数据、选择颜色配置,并展示生成的二维码。 除了基本的生成功能外,该生成器还支持添加动态背景和logo。通过引入GIF或视频元素作为动态背景,使二维码不再局限于静态图像形式;而logo则可在不影响扫描效果的前提下提升品牌形象,提高识别度。 在中文字符的支持方面,“qrcode库”能够处理UTF-8编码的文本信息,在生成过程中将这些字符串转换为二进制数据并进行相应编码操作,最终形成包含完整信息的二维码图案。 实际应用中,这种“qrcode二维码生成器”的用途广泛。例如:可以在产品包装上添加含有详细说明的二维码;在活动海报中嵌入带注册链接的二维码以简化参与流程;甚至还可以将个人名片变成只需扫描即可获取所有联系资料的形式等。 结合了Python qrcode库与Pyside2强大功能,“qrcode二维码生成器”为用户提供了一种高度定制化的体验。无论是颜色搭配、动态背景还是中文支持,都体现了技术与艺术的完美融合。对于开发者而言,这不仅是一个实用工具,也是学习Python GUI编程和二维码技术的一个优秀案例。
  • C#DataMatrix.net和打印
    优质
    本文章介绍了如何使用C#编程语言结合DataMatrix.net库来实现数据矩阵(QR码的一种)的生成与打印功能。非常适合需要在项目中集成二维码解决方案的技术开发者阅读和应用。 使用DataMatrix.net库进行标签打印的示例代码如下: ```csharp // 示例代码:使用 DataMatrix.net 库生成并打印条形码 using System; using DataMatrixNet; namespace BarcodePrintingExample { class Program { static void Main(string[] args) { // 创建一个DataMatrix对象实例,并设置编码文本和属性。 var dataMatrix = new DataMatrix(); // 设置要编码的数据内容,例如产品序列号、生产日期等信息。 string encodedText = 1234567890; dataMatrix.TextToEncode = encodedText; // 可以根据需要设置条形码的大小、颜色以及其他属性。 dataMatrix.Size = 2; // 设置尺寸 dataMatrix.Color = System.Drawing.Color.Black; // 设置颜色 // 输出生成的数据矩阵图像到文件或直接打印标签。 string outputPath = output.png; dataMatrix.SaveImage(outputPath); Console.WriteLine(条形码已保存至:{0}, outputPath); } } } ``` 以上代码片段展示了如何使用DataMatrix.net库来创建和输出一个包含特定文本数据的二维条形码图像。在实际应用中,可以进一步调整参数以适应不同的打印需求或集成到更复杂的标签设计流程当中。
  • Pythonqrcode码库码的方法详解
    优质
    本篇文章将详细介绍如何使用Python中的qrcode库来生成二维码。包括安装步骤、基本用法及进阶技巧。适合对Python编程有一定了解,并希望掌握二维码操作的技术爱好者和开发者阅读。 本段落主要介绍了使用Python的qrcode库生成二维码的方法,并提供了详细的指南供需要的朋友参考。